Moonshot dropped the full weights for Kimi K3, a 2.8 trillion parameter model, onto Hugging Face this week. Within hours the same weights were circulating on r/LocalLLaMA. In the same week, Anthropic CEO Dario Amodei published the company's formal position on open-weight models, arguing for tighter control over who gets to distill and self-host frontier-class systems. Nvidia's Jensen Huang pushed back within days, framing the fight as needing both open and closed frontier models, and helped launch the Open Secure AI Alliance with Microsoft, SpaceX, and more than 40 other members to keep open models available to security defenders. OpenAI signed on as a member too, an odd fit given its own model was the reason Hugging Face needed defending in the first place.
Read one way, this is a security fight. Read from an operator's cost sheet, it's a fight over which layer of the stack gets to be the moat, and Anthropic just told everyone which layer it's betting on.
Kimi K3 is the useful data point here: it undercuts the urgency of Anthropic's position more than it threatens it directly. The weights are a 1.56 terabyte download, and early testers report the model needs data-center-scale hardware most operator teams simply don't own; a handful of consumer GPUs won't get you there. Full open-weight parity at 2.8 trillion parameters is real, and it's also irrelevant to a five-person team deciding what to build on this quarter. Frontier lock-in depends on what gets built on top of the weights, not on whether the weights themselves match frontier quality.
I've been running Income Factory on Claude Opus and hitting cost limits doing it. The fix isn't abandoning Opus, it's routing: simpler reasoning goes to an open-weight model, heavy reasoning stays on Opus. That hybrid stack, not a wholesale swap to open-weight, is where most operators who actually run the cost math end up. Frontier labs can't win on model quality alone once open-weight closes the gap on the easy 80 percent of the workload. What they can still win on is the application sitting on top: Claude Code, Harvey, the tooling that makes the model usable without the operator assembling the pipeline themselves. Same lock-in Apple built with a phone that just works, applied to a different decade and a different product category. Consumer lock-in was ease of use. Enterprise lock-in is scaffolding into the systems a company already runs.
Anthropic's position paper argues security. It also happens to defend the layer of the stack Anthropic is best positioned to defend right now, before open-weight erodes the model-quality argument entirely.
